Randy-HeadLast week the Senate Committee on Veterans Affairs and the Military advanced three bills that provide support for Hoosier veterans.

The bills that passed out of Tuesday’s committee are:

  • SB 298 – Provides for a voluntary veterans’ preference policy for hiring, promoting, or retaining a veteran in private employment.
  • SB 262 – Increases the income tax deduction for military retirement or survivor’s benefits from $5,000 to $25,000.
  • SB 424 – Requires the director of veterans’ affairs to designate a coordinator for the Hoosier women veterans program.

These proposals will now be considered by the full Senate.
